Border Patrol and Coast Guard operate 10 Hermes-900, Air Force bought 16 Heron MALE UAVs + production license of different versions, including a jointly developed armed version with a 1 ton payload.
Nice numbers. But Heron cant carry 1 ton payload. Maybe You mean a version of Heron TP - Eitan?
 
Nice numbers. But Heron cant carry 1 ton payload. Maybe You mean a version of Heron TP - Eitan?

production license covers multiple versions of Heron, the armed version is based on Heron-TP-XP and has the local designation of Zerbe-5

Leonardo has secured a launch order for six examples of the M-346FA
I believe the launch customer is Azerbaijan, more specifically Border Patrol, as they have been looking towards increasing their capabilities through use of light aviation.
